COLLEGE STATION, Texas - Winners of three of its last four games, the Texas A&M baseball team heads east to Huntsville on Tuesday to battle Sam Houston State. First pitch at Don Sanders Stadium is set for 6:30 p.m.
The Aggies (25-17-1) enter the contest fresh off a series win against Nebraska over the weekend in Lincoln. A&M currently sits in fifth place in the Big 12 at 9-11-1 and has the upcoming weekend off from conference play due to finals.
The Bearkats, meanwhile, come in with a 17-28 record and 9-15 mark in Southland Conference play. SHSU has lost 10 of its last 12 including a sweep at the hands of Stephen F. Austin this past weekend in Huntsville.
Texas A&M leads the all-time series, which dates back to 1950, 83-36-2. The Aggies have won four straight and are unbeaten against Sam Houston in their last 15 contests.
